as posted by the channelThe British monarchy is in the midst of one of its most tumultuous times in recent history. Queen Elizabeth announced Monday that she would be open to a new arrangement that would allow Prince Harry and Meghan Markle to pursue a life outside their royal obligations. Amna Nawaz reports and talks to Robert Lacey, a royal historian, about whether the family can successfully reinvent itself.
